Sugarland Industries reported a net income of $750,750 on December 31, 2018. At the beginning of the year, the company had 500,000 common shares outstanding. On April 1, the company sold 27,000 shares for cash. On August 31, the company issued 48,000 additional shares as part of a merger.
Required:
Compute Sugarland's net income that would produce a basic EPS of $2.00 per share for 2018.
Dissociative Disorder
A mental health condition that involves disruptions or breakdowns of memory, awareness, identity, or perception, often in response to trauma or stress.
Obsessive-compulsive Disorder
A mental health disorder characterized by unwanted, intrusive thoughts (obsessions) and repetitive behaviors (compulsions) seeking to alleviate anxiety.
Dissociative Identity Disorder
A complex psychological condition characterized by the presence of two or more distinct personality states or identities within a single individual.
